引言
在Web开发中,HTML是构建网页的基本骨架,而jQuery则是一个强大的JavaScript库,它可以帮助开发者简化HTML操作,提高开发效率。本文将详细介绍如何使用jQuery进行HTML操作,并通过详细的代码示例来帮助读者更好地理解。
什么是jQuery
jQuery是一个快速、小型且功能丰富的JavaScript库。它通过简洁的API封装了JavaScript的DOM操作、事件处理、动画效果等功能,使得开发者可以更加高效地编写JavaScript代码。
jQuery的基本使用
要使用jQuery,首先需要在HTML文件中引入jQuery库。可以通过以下代码实现: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
引入jQuery后,就可以使用它的API进行HTML操作了。
1. 选择器
jQuery中最常用的功能之一就是选择器。选择器可以用来选中页面上的元素,然后对其进行操作。以下是一些常用的选择器示例:
1.1 基本选择器
// 选择id为"myElement"的元素
$("#myElement");
// 选择class为"myClass"的元素
$(".myClass");
// 选择标签名为"div"的元素
$("div");
1.2 属性选择器
// 选择所有具有特定属性的元素
$("[attribute]");
// 选择具有特定属性值的元素
$("[attribute=value]");
// 选择具有多个属性值的元素
$("[attribute=value][attribute=value]");
2. HTML操作
使用jQuery进行HTML操作非常简单,以下是一些常用的操作方法:
2.1 设置和获取HTML内容
// 设置元素的HTML内容
$("#myElement").html("新的内容");
// 获取元素的HTML内容
var htmlContent = $("#myElement").html();
2.2 设置和获取文本内容
// 设置元素的文本内容
$("#myElement").text("新的文本");
// 获取元素的文本内容
var textContent = $("#myElement").text();
2.3 添加和删除元素
// 向元素内部添加新的HTML内容
$("#myElement").append("<p>新的段落</p>");
// 向元素外部添加新的HTML内容
$("#myElement").after("<p>新的段落</p>");
// 删除元素
$("#myElement").remove();
3. 事件处理
jQuery提供了丰富的事件处理功能,以下是一些常用的事件处理方法:
3.1 绑定事件
// 绑定点击事件
$("#myElement").click(function() {
alert("点击了元素!");
});
3.2 解除事件绑定
// 解除点击事件绑定
$("#myElement").off("click");
4. 动画
jQuery提供了强大的动画功能,可以轻松实现元素的显示、隐藏、滚动等效果。
4.1 显示和隐藏元素
// 显示元素
$("#myElement").show();
// 隐藏元素
$("#myElement").hide();
4.2 滚动效果
// 滚动到指定位置
$("#myElement").scrollTop(100);
// 滚动到顶部
$("#myElement").scrollTop(0);
总结
通过本文的介绍,相信你已经对使用jQuery进行HTML操作有了初步的了解。在实际开发中,jQuery可以帮助你简化代码,提高开发效率。希望本文的代码示例能帮助你更好地掌握jQuery,为你的Web开发之路添砖加瓦。
